Raspberry pi series are affordable programmable computer hardware which helps us to make programmable embedded systems. Raspberry Pi No is one of the same series but is much smaller in form. It really is ultra thin Pi board which is only 65mm long by 30mm large and 5mm profound. To save space the mother board has little connectors and 40 unpopulated GPIO pins gives flexibility to an individual. Normally, a Pi plank may be considered a little heavy on your pocket but Pi No intends to be on another note both both literally and financially as it cost much less than any Pi planks and also is much smaller in size, a perfect basic level product.

The wingsuit was created to allow the wind flow to feed channels sewn into the wings of the suit. This creates an airfoil which produces lift up, enabling flight. The glide ratio, also known as efficiency, is 2.5 for most wingsuits. Which means that for each two feet dropped, there are five ft of forward motion. A combo of body maneuvers and suit design allows the flyer to control both the forwards rate and the show up rate. A flyer can also control aspects of trip by changing the positions of the torso, shoulders, hips and legs. These actions change where in fact the wind makes contact with the wingsuit and in doing so produce the required changes in in front momentum and drop.
